NCBI Bioinformatics Tools: An Introduction
Event box
Location: Bioscience Library Training Room, 2101 VLSB
Description: A hands-on workshop introducing NCBI bioinformatics tools such as PubMed, Gene, Protein, Nucleotide, and BLAST:
* Starting with a disease, syndrome, or process, identify the genes/proteins involved
* Starting with an organism and a protein, find the protein sequence and gene coding region
* Starting with a sequence, identify the gene/protein and source
The workshop will cover selecting the proper tools for your question, navigating through the interlinked NCBI databases, and saving your results.
